Generally, for patients with bed sores, it's important to consider the following:
- Pressure relief: Beds with adjustable positions and pressure-relieving features, such as alternating pressure mattresses or foam overlays, may be beneficial for relieving pressure on the affected area.
- Positioning: Adjust the bed to positions that alleviate pressure on the bed sore. This may involve elevating the head, foot, or specific areas of the bed to distribute pressure more evenly.
- Mobility and transfers: Consider the patient's mobility needs and the ease of transferring in and out of bed. Some beds offer features like adjustable heights or side rails to assist with safe and convenient transfers.
It's crucial to involve healthcare professionals to ensure the bed is set correctly and meets the patient's specific needs. They will be able to provide appropriate guidance based on the patient's condition and the recommendations of the healthcare team overseeing their care.
